Libee's Sports Bar &Grill

Rating: 4.3/5 (402 reviews)

Details

Address: 1859 Englewood Rd, Englewood, FL 34223

Type: Sports bar

Category: bar & grill in North Port, Florida, USA

Phone: (941) 208-6330

Website: http://www.libeessportsbar.com/

Price: $$

Service Options: Outdoor seating, Takeout, Dine-in

Location

1859 Englewood Rd, Englewood, FL 34223

📍 View in Google Maps

Hours

Tuesday Closed
Wednesday 11 AM–9 PM
Thursday 11 AM–9 PM
Friday 11 AM–10 PM
Saturday 11 AM–10 PM
Sunday 11 AM–9 PM
Monday 11 AM–9 PM
Libee's Sports Bar &Grill

Nearby Cities